Jobs Campaign Day of Action – The Final Week!

On Saturday 28th September, Liberal Democrats across the country will be taking part in a national Day of Action to celebrate our success in helping add over one million new jobs to the economy since 2010 and calling for a million more.

Alongside the positive job creation figures, Liberal Democrats can also be proud of our role in the record expansion of apprenticeships for young people and the creation of the Youth Contract to target youth unemployment, which remains stubbornly high.

The Jobs Day of Action aims to generate national and regional coverage that will amplify the actions that Lib Dem campaigners take locally to spread this positive message. The party are giving support, including a range of artwork materials and planning packs, to all teams taking part.

Other tasks for the final week include:

  • Final phone around of friends and helpers, firm up promises and get arrival times from your definites
  • Maps, maps, maps! – walk maps, Action Day HQ maps, make sure every angle is covered
  • Leaflets printed, bundled and ready to distribute
  • Lists in Connect, if your activities involve targeted door-knocking or phoning
